What was the financial power of congress under the articles of confederation

Social Studies
1 answer:
photoshop1234 [79]3 years ago
7 0
The correct answer is c. it could only request states for funds

That was because the government wasn't centralized as everyone was afraid that it could become a tyrannical government.

How did Franklin D. Roosevelt modify the Resolute Desk?
Alex777 [14]
Roosevelt ordered a hinged front panel for the keyhole opening in order to hide his leg braces.
